Family Offices & Multifamily: Where the Smart Money Goes

from The LSCRE Podcast · host Rob Beardsley

In this episode, Craig McGrouther sits down with Bernard Pierson, co-founder of EHP Capital, who's been LP investing since 2012 and now focuses on value-add multifamily in Kansas City. Bernard reveals a counterintuitive insight from his 50+ LP investments: deals projecting 15-17% IRRs often outperformed those advertising 30%+ returns. He shares how Kansas City has consistently ranked in the top 5 U.S. markets for rent growth over the past 3 years while avoiding the supply issues plaguing gateway markets. Bernard breaks down their operational value-add approach, including discovering 200 unchecked voicemails on a property's leasing line that no one was monitoring. With family office investors from Latin America, EHP targets 17-18% IRRs, 5-7% cash-on-cash, and 2x equity multiples using conservative 60% LTV agency debt. His key lesson: the boring, down-the-fairway deals often deliver the best risk-adjusted returns.Learn more about LSCRE:www.lscre.com
